Senate Bill 1116
Sponsored by Senator STARR (at the request of Oregon Building
Industry Association)
SUMMARY
The following summary is not prepared by the sponsors of the
measure and is not a part of the body thereof subject to
consideration by the Legislative Assembly. It is an editor's
brief statement of the essential features of the measure as
introduced.
Requires building designers to register with Department of
Consumer and Business Services. Requires three years of
experience as general contractor prior to registration. Requires
six hours of continuing education for building designers. Exempts
registered architects and engineers.
A BILL FOR AN ACT
Relating to building designers.
Be It Enacted by the People of the State of Oregon:
SECTION 1. { + Section 2 of this 1999 Act is added to and made
a part of ORS chapter 455. + }
SECTION 2. { + (1) A person shall not engage in the business
or practice of preparing building designs for one and two family
dwellings or farm buildings unless the person is registered with
the Department of Consumer and Business Services.
(2) A person registered as a building designer under this
section may produce plans and specifications for one and two
family dwellings and farm buildings, either in pursuit of the
registrant's own business or for a person with whom the
registrant is under contract or employed. The plans and
specifications may not be sold, traded or otherwise conveyed to a
third party for use by the third party in constructing a dwelling
or farm building or developing other plans and specifications.
(3)(a) The Director of the Department of Consumer and Business
Services by rule shall establish a registration system for
building designers. The department shall allow any person who has
three or more consecutive years of experience as a general
contractor to register as a building designer. The registration
system shall provide for initial registration and periodic
reregistration.
(b) As a condition of reregistration, the director shall
require a registrant to demonstrate not less than six hours
annually of continuing education in the One and Two Family
Dwelling Code adopted under ORS 455.610.
(4) The provisions of this section do not apply to a person
registered as an architect under ORS 671.020 or as an engineer
under ORS 672.020.
(5) The director may adopt registration fees as reasonable and
necessary for the administration and enforcement of this
section. + }
